Magic: The Gathering is diving back into the nostalgic world of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les with an exciting new set that brings to life a roster of 18 villains. Fans of the franchise are in for a treat, as this collection taps into a rich tapestry of characters from comics, cartoons, and toys that span four decades.
From the quirky charm of Pizza Face to the more enigmatic presence of Tempestra, each villain has been thoughtfully revived, allowing players to immerse themselves in a familiar yet fresh experience.
